Job Summary

A Marketing intern assists with the tasks and projects required to create leads for various digital platforms that InsureShield® shipping insurance is sold on. The intern will help synthesize outside data to find potential customers, create and execute Marketing campaigns, and analyze the results of these campaigns. The intern will be expected to work cross-functionally with various teams, especially inside Sales teams and other Marketing teams. The intern will have the opportunity to learn about Marketing Analytics, initiate their own projects of interest, and develop communication and networking skills.

Responsibilities

  • Assist in the planning and creation of innovative marketing campaigns and messaging
  • Create Marketing Qualified Leads by analyzing engagement on marketing campaigns
  • Perform daily reporting and pass Marketing Qualified Leads along to the inside Sales team for implementation
  • Work with Marketing interns in various teams on a collaborative project aimed at driving the company forward
  • Communicate project outcomes both within team and to various stakeholders and senior management
  • Support Digital Channel Marketing team by assisting with various tasks and projects

Preferences

  • Proficient in Microsoft Excel and Microsoft PowerPoint
  • Possesses strong communication (written/verbal) skills
  • Demonstrates analytical problem-solving skills
  • Displays project management skills and can be organized while working on several projects simultaneously
  • Takes initiative, is a quick learner, and is willing to adapt and learn new things
